In a fitting follow-up to its latest software update which is the iOS 8.0.2, technology titan is not resting on its laurel as it launches series of features to boost its stock further.


Apple gained momentum shortly after it released its flagship phones but the bendgate issue and the flawed iOS 8.0.1 caused some chink on Apple's mighty armor. Apple's latest iOS 8.0.2 software update somewhat solved the company's woes.


According to iDownloadBlog, the new section dedicated to 'Apps for Health' can be accessed from the Featured tab in the App Store, using iPhone and iPod touch device. You can also see the app in the home page for iPhone apps in the App Store using a desktop computer.


The new section which is titled 'Apps for Health' is endorsed by Apple and comes with some contents which read as, ' Experience an entirely new approach to wellness where your fitness app can talk to your calorie tracker, your doctor can be automatically notified of updates to your health data, and great apps work together for a healthier you. This handpicked collection highlights the best fitness, nutrition, and medical apps customized for iOS 8.'


This new section was probably set to be announced as part of the launching of the iOS 8 on September 17. But then a bug in the first release of the latest major iteration of Apple's mobile operating system paved the way for the momentary elimination of HealthKit-compatible apps in the App Store.


That bug was expected to be fixed with the release of the iOS 8.0.1 software update but this turned out to be plagued with a bug as well. The bug give rise to loss of cellular network connectivity and Touch ID functionality on both iPhone 6 and iPhone 6 Plus. With the release of the iOS 8.0.2 software, however, Apple finally solved its problems.


Apart from 'Apps for Health,' Apple also now comes with the following sections on the App Store in promotion of apps augmented for iOS 8 such as Photo Apps for iOS 8: Tools for Better Pictures,' 'Touch ID: Unlock Apps with Your Fingerprint, ' 'Gorgeous Games for iOS 8: Enhanced by Metal,' and 'Extend Your Apps: Keyboards, Photo Filters & More.'
